Power BI Developer
Chisei Analytics Ltd., London
• Cooperate with business partners to identify key metrics and enhance critical business processes. • Design business-relevant reports and dashboards. • Develop reports and dashboards in Power BI and maintain existing ones.
Job Requirements
- 5+ years’ experience with Power BI development.
- Good understanding of DAX language.
- Hands-on experience with MS SQL Server 2012+, T-SQL, SSIS, SSAS, SSRS is a plus.
- Understanding of database warehousing concepts.
- Experience with Microsoft Dynamics AX, Jira, Git are a plus.
